The Philippines` food thickeners import market continues to be dominated by key exporting countries such as Singapore, Malaysia, China, Thailand, and South Korea in 2024. The high Herfindahl-Hirschman Index (HHI) indicates a concentrated market landscape. With a remarkable comp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 60.25% from 2020 to 2024, the industry demonstrates robust expansion. Moreover, the impressive growth rate of 25.16% from 2023 to 2024 underscores the increasing demand for food thickeners in the Philippines, positioning it as a lucrative market for both domestic and international suppliers.

The food thickeners market in the Philippines is primarily driven by the aging population and the rising prevalence of swallowing disorders (dysphagia). Food thickeners are crucial in modifying the texture of foods and liquids for individuals with dysphagia. The healthcare sector`s demand, coupled with their use in food production, contributes to the market`s expansion.
The Philippines food thickeners market faces challenges related to meeting consumer expectations for both texture and health. Thickeners play a crucial role in achieving desired food textures, but there`s a growing demand for clean-label and natural thickeners that align with health-conscious trends. Manufacturers must balance these demands while maintaining the taste and appearance of food products. Moreover, regulatory compliance and addressing potential allergen concerns can pose hurdles for market players.
The Philippines food thickeners market faced difficulties during the pandemic. The closure of foodservice establishments and reduced manufacturing capacities impacted the demand for food thickeners used in various culinary applications. The market saw fluctuations as consumers turned to home cooking and sought convenience in ready-to-eat meals. Food manufacturers faced challenges in maintaining steady production, which affected the supply chain for thickeners. However, as the situation stabilized and consumption patterns adapted to the new normal, the market started recovering with increased demand for both home-cooked and processed foods.
